Last Updated: January 15, 2026
Table of Contents
- PayPal Does NOT Work in Bangladesh!
- Starting My Journey: Getting iOS Development Jobs on Upwork
- Payment Methods: Bangladesh
- Understanding the Upwork Landscape for iOS Development
- Navigating Job Listings
- Crafting a Winning Proposal
- Building a Strong Profile
- My Experience: What I Learned Along the Way
- Practical Tips for Bangladeshi iOS Developers on Upwork
- Conclusion
- About the Author
- Frequently Asked Questions
- How much can I earn from freelancing in Bangladesh?
- Why doesn't PayPal work in Bangladesh?
- What do I need to start freelancing?
- Related Articles
- Rahim Ahmed
- Start Earning
- Payments
- Company
This guide covers everything you need to know about how to get ios development jobs on Upwork bangladesh (2026). Includes practical steps and tips for Bangladeshi freelancers.
Starting My Journey: Getting iOS Development Jobs on Upwork
When I first started freelancing, I faced a mountain of challenges—especially in the tech space. As an iOS developer working from Dhaka, I had no clue how to navigate platforms like Upwork. The competition was fierce. I remember spending countless nights fine-tuning my profile, hoping to land my first job. In the beginning, I was just like many of you, unsure and overwhelmed.
However, after a lot of trial and error, I managed to earn over $100,000 through freelancing, and a significant portion of that came from Upwork. If you're looking to break into the iOS development scene on Upwork, I’m here to share my journey and insights that could help you land those jobs.
Understanding the Upwork Landscape for iOS Development
Before diving into the specifics of landing jobs, it’s crucial to understand the Upwork ecosystem—especially for iOS developers in Bangladesh. As of 2023, Upwork is one of the leading freelancing platforms, connecting millions of freelancers with clients from around the world.
Here are some key points about the platform:
- Global Reach: Upwork has clients from various countries, which means diverse job opportunities.
- Payment Integration: Upwork supports Payoneer, which is beneficial since PayPal does not work in Bangladesh. This allows you to withdraw your earnings to local banks like DBBL and MCB.
- Profile Visibility: A well-optimized profile can increase your chances of getting hired. Clients often look for freelancers with a strong portfolio and testimonials.
When I first joined Upwork, I spent time researching successful profiles and realized that showcasing my skills and previous work was vital. I learned that a good profile picture, a compelling bio, and a detailed list of skills can significantly impact your chances of landing a job.
Navigating Job Listings
Once your profile is ready, the next step is to find suitable job listings. iOS development jobs can vary widely in scope and budget. Here’s how to effectively navigate job listings:
- Search Filters: Use specific keywords like "iOS developer," "Swift," or "Objective-C" to filter your job search. This will help you find jobs that match your skill set.
- Set Alerts: Upwork allows you to set job alerts based on your criteria. This feature can save you time and ensure you don’t miss out on new postings.
- Evaluate Job Posts: Look for jobs with a clear description and a reasonable budget. For instance, I often targeted projects in the $500 to $2,000 range, as these typically provided a good return on investment for the hours worked.
I remember an instance where I stumbled upon a job listing for an iOS app development project. The client was offering $1,500 for a three-month project. I pitched my services, showcasing similar projects I had completed. Luckily, I secured that job, and it became a stepping stone for more opportunities.
Crafting a Winning Proposal
A strong proposal can make or break your chances of getting hired. Here are some strategies I employed that proved effective:
- Personalization: Tailor each proposal to the specific job. Mention the client's name and address their needs directly.
- Portfolio Links: Include links to relevant work samples. For instance, if you built an app similar to what the client is looking for, highlight that.
- Clear Communication: Keep your proposal concise but informative. Outline how you plan to approach the project and your estimated timeline.
One of my most successful proposals was for a client looking to develop a fitness app. I took the time to research their existing app and suggested enhancements based on user feedback I found online. This level of detail impressed the client, leading to a contract worth $2,000.
Building a Strong Profile
Your Upwork profile is your digital storefront. Here’s how to make it shine:
- Profile Picture: Use a professional-looking photo. A friendly smile can go a long way in building trust.
- Title and Overview: Clearly state your role as an iOS developer. Your overview should summarize your skills, experience, and what makes you unique.
- Skills and Certifications: List relevant skills, including programming languages, tools, and any certifications. Having a BASIS registration can add credibility to your profile.
When I updated my profile to reflect my BASIS registration, I noticed a significant uptick in job invitations. Clients appreciated the added layer of professionalism.
My Experience: What I Learned Along the Way
Freelancing is not without its challenges. I faced numerous obstacles, from dealing with difficult clients to managing payment issues. However, these experiences shaped my journey.
For instance, I once worked with a client who delayed the payment, which was frustrating. I learned the importance of setting clear milestones and payment terms upfront. This way, both parties have a clear understanding of expectations.
Moreover, I can’t stress enough the importance of using Payoneer for payments. When I first started, the lack of PayPal in Bangladesh was a setback, but switching to Payoneer opened up a world of possibilities. It allowed me to withdraw my earnings to local banks like DBBL, MCB, and UBL without hassle.
Practical Tips for Bangladeshi iOS Developers on Upwork
Now that you have some insights into getting iOS development jobs on Upwork, here are practical steps you can take:
- Optimize Your Profile:
- Invest time in crafting a compelling profile.
- Regularly update your portfolio with new projects.
- Network with Other Freelancers:
- Join Bangladeshi Freelancer groups on social media and platforms like LinkedIn.
- Share experiences, job leads, and tips with others.
- Utilize Upwork Community Resources:
- Engage in Upwork forums and webinars to learn from successful freelancers.
- Attend online workshops to improve your skills.
- Stay Updated on iOS Trends:
- Follow industry news and updates on iOS development.
- Consider taking online courses to expand your knowledge.
- Use Payoneer Effectively:
- Sign up for Payoneer and link it to your Upwork account for seamless transactions.
- Explore their referral program, where you can earn a $25 bonus for signing up.
Conclusion
Getting iOS development jobs on Upwork from Bangladesh is entirely possible with the right approach and determination. I’ve shared my journey, the lessons I learned, and actionable steps you can take to carve out your freelancing path. Remember, success doesn’t come overnight, but with persistence and the right strategies, you can achieve your goals.
I encourage you to take the leap, invest in your skills, and leverage platforms like Upwork to unlock your full potential as a freelancer. Your journey to financial freedom starts now!
| Platform | Commission | Popularity in BD | Best For |
|---|---|---|---|
| Fiverr | 20% | Very High | Design, Writing |
| Upwork | 10-20% | High | Web Development |
| Freelancer | 10% | Medium | Various projects |
Disclaimer: This article is for informational purposes only. Platform policies, fees, and features may change. Please verify current terms on the official platform website. Earnings mentioned are examples and your results may vary based on skills, effort, and market conditions.
Frequently Asked Questions
Bangladeshi freelancers typically earn $500 to $5000+ monthly depending on skills and experience.
PayPal hasn't officially launched in Bangladesh. Use Payoneer instead - it works with all major platforms.
You need a computer, internet, a skill, Payoneer account, and profiles on Fiverr or Upwork.